一种智能卡的个人化方法及装置制造方法及图纸

技术编号:19027239 阅读:29 留言:0更新日期:2018-09-26 20:05
本发明专利技术公开了一种智能卡的个人化方法及装置。该方法包括:存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息;开机时获取当前智能卡中的预设信息通过所述预设处理算法处理后得到的第二信息;将所述第二信息与存储的第一信息进行比对,并根据比对的结果判断当前智能卡是否可用。本发明专利技术提供的方法解决了现有技术中增加IMSI暴露的安全风险的问题,提高了智能卡中重要信息的安全性,同时可实现在智能终端丢失后,更换的智能卡无法在丢失的智能终端中使用。

【技术实现步骤摘要】
一种智能卡的个人化方法及装置
本专利技术实施例涉及移动通信
,尤其涉及一种智能卡的个人化方法及装置。
技术介绍
随着智能终端的不断发展,智能终端在人们的生活中得到普及。例如,手机已经成为人们生活中不可或缺的重要组成部分。然而由于人们疏忽或其他各种原因,可能会导致智能终端丢失。为了防止智能终端丢失后,被其他人更换智能卡后直接使用,可将智能卡进行个人化,即将智能卡与智能终端绑定,在智能终端丢失后,更换的智能卡不可在丢失的智能终端使用。目前的智能卡的个人化方法中,一般是将IMSI(InternationalMobileSubscriberIdentificationNumber,国际移动用户识别码)保存在智能终端的非易失性存储器中,在智能终端每次开机时,获取智能卡中的IMSI,若获取的IMSI与智能终端中保存的IMSI相同,则该智能卡可用,否则该智能卡不可用。然而,上述方法中,直接将IMSI存储在智能终端中,增加了IMSI暴露的安全风险,在智能终端丢失后,易被他人获取到存储的在非易失存储器中的IMSI,从而被非法使用。
技术实现思路
本专利技术提供一种智能卡的个人化方法及装置,以解决现有技术中增加IMSI暴露的安全风险的问题,提高智能卡中重要信息的安全性。第一方面,本专利技术实施例提供了一种智能卡的个人化方法,该方法包括:存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息;开机时获取当前智能卡中的预设信息通过所述预设处理算法处理后得到的第二信息;将所述第二信息与存储的第一信息进行比对,并根据比对的结果判断当前智能卡是否可用。第二方面,本专利技术实施例还提供了一种智能卡的个人化装置,该装置包括:第一信息存储模块,用于存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息;第二信息获取模块,用于开机时获取当前智能卡中的预设信息通过所述预设处理算法处理后得到的第二信息;信息比对模块,用于将所述第二信息与存储的第一信息进行比对,并根据比对的结果判断当前智能卡是否可用。本专利技术通过存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息;开机时获取当前智能卡中的预设信息通过预设处理算法处理后得到的第二信息;将第二信息与存储的第一信息进行比对,并根据比对的结果判断当前智能卡是否可用。解决了现有技术中增加IMSI暴露的安全风险的问题,提高了智能卡中重要信息的安全性,同时可实现在智能终端丢失后,更换的智能卡无法在丢失的智能终端中使用。附图说明图1是本专利技术实施例一中的一种智能卡的个人化方法的流程图;图2是本专利技术实施例二中的一种智能卡的个人化方法的流程图;图3是本专利技术实施例三中的一种智能卡的个人化方法的流程图;图4是本专利技术实施例四中的一种智能卡的个人化装置的结构框图。具体实施方式下面结合附图和实施例对本专利技术作进一步的详细说明。可以理解的是,此处所描述的具体实施例仅仅用于解释本专利技术,而非对本专利技术的限定。另外还需要说明的是,为了便于描述,附图中仅示出了与本专利技术相关的部分而非全部结构。实施例一图1为本专利技术实施例一提供的一种智能卡的个人化方法的流程图,本实施例可适用于需将智能卡进行个人化的情况,该方法可以由智能卡的个人化装置来执行,该装置可由软件和\或硬件组成。本专利技术实施例提供的方法具体包括如下步骤:步骤110、存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息。其中,智能卡为智能终端中所使用的用于用户身份识别的USIM(UniversalSubscriberIdentityModule,全球用户识别模块)或SIM(SubscriberIdentificationModule,用户识别模块)等智能卡。智能卡中存储有数字移动电话用户的信息,加密的密钥以及用户的电话簿等信息。预设信息可为智能卡中存储的任何信息。优选的,预设信息为智能卡中存储的可唯一标识用户的信息,如IMSI,从而通过预设信息将智能卡与智能终端进行绑定,提高将智能卡进行个人化的可靠性,避免智能终端丢失后,预设信息暴露,被他人将暴露的预设信息写入另一智能卡中,从而将该智能卡插入丢失的终端中继续使用。其中,第一信息为由预设信息通过预设处理算法处理后得到的,存储处理后得到的第一信息,可避免直接存储IMSI等预设信息,在存储的预设信息暴露后被他人非法使用,提高预设信息的安全性。本专利技术实施例中,对预设处理算法不进行限定。例如,预设处理算法可以为线性散列算法,如MD5(Message-DigestAlgorithm5,信息-摘要算法5)或SHA1(SecureHashAlgorithm,安全哈希算法),也可以为对称加密算法,如AES(AdvancedEncryptionStandard,高级加密标准)或DES(DataEncryptionStandard,数据加密标准),还可以为非对称加密算法,如DSA(DigitalSignatureAlgorithm,数字签名算法)或ECC(EllipticCurvesCryptography,椭圆曲线密码编码学)。优选的,可存储多个智能卡中的预设信息分别通过预设处理算法处理后得到的第一信息。如智能终端中可插入2个智能卡,分别为卡1和卡2,则可获取卡1和卡2中的预设信息分别通过预设处理算法处理后得到的第一信息,并将获取到的两个第一信息存储。步骤120、开机时获取当前智能卡中的预设信息通过预设处理算法处理后得到的第二信息。其中,第二信息为智能终端中当前插入的智能卡中的预设信息通过预设处理算法得到的。智能终端开机时,获取第二信息。步骤130、将第二信息与存储的第一信息进行比对,并根据比对的结果判断当前智能卡是否可用。得到第二信息后,将得到的第二信息与存储的第一信息进行比对,若比对结果成功,则当前智能卡可用,允许智能卡进行网络鉴别等功能,若比对结果失败,则当前智能卡不可用。优选的,若智能终端中存储有多个智能卡中的预设信息通过预设处理算法处理后得到的第一信息,例如存储有卡1和卡2中的预设信息分别通过预设处理算法处理后得到的第一信息,则在开机时,可分别获取智能终端中卡1位置和卡2位置当前插入的智能卡中的预设信息通过预设处理算法处理得到的第二信息,分别将智能卡位置对应的第二信息与第一信息进行比对,若某一智能卡位置对应的第二信息与第一信息比对结果成功,则该智能卡位置当前插入的智能卡可用;否则,该智能卡位置当前插入的智能卡不可用。由此,在智能终端丢失的情况下,若将丢失的智能终端中的智能卡更换,则在开机时,由于获取的第二信息与存储的第一信息比对失败,更换后的智能卡无法使用。优选的,若比对结果失败次数超过预设次数,还可通过将智能终端的硬件损坏或其它方式,使得智能终端无法继续使用。本专利技术实施例通过存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息;开机时获取当前智能卡中的预设信息通过预设处理算法处理后得到的第二信息;将第二信息与存储的第一信息进行比对,并根据比对的结果判断当前智能卡是否可用。解决了现有技术中增加IMSI暴露的安全风险的问题,提高了智能卡中重要信息的安全性,同时可实现在智能终端丢失后,更换的智能卡无法在丢失的智能终端中使用。实施例二图2为本专利技术实施例二提供的一种智能卡的个人化方法的流程图。本实施例为在上述实施例的基础上进行进一步本文档来自技高网...

【技术保护点】
1.一种智能卡的个人化方法,其特征在于,包括:存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息;开机时获取当前智能卡中的预设信息通过所述预设处理算法处理后得到的第二信息;将所述第二信息与存储的第一信息进行比对,并根据比对的结果判断当前智能卡是否可用。

【技术特征摘要】
1.一种智能卡的个人化方法,其特征在于,包括:存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息;开机时获取当前智能卡中的预设信息通过所述预设处理算法处理后得到的第二信息;将所述第二信息与存储的第一信息进行比对,并根据比对的结果判断当前智能卡是否可用。2.根据权利要求1所述的方法,其特征在于,所述存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息,包括:获取智能卡中的预设信息;将所述预设信息通过预设处理算法处理后得到第一信息并存储所述第一信息;相应的,所述开机时获取当前智能卡中的预设信息通过所述预设处理算法处理后得到的第二信息,包括:开机时获取当前智能卡中的预设信息;将所述当前智能卡中的预设信息通过所述预设处理算法处理后得到第二信息。3.根据权利要求1所述的方法,其特征在于,所述存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息,包括:从智能卡获取第一信息并存储所述第一信息,所述第一信息为所述预设信息通过预设处理算法处理后得到;相应的,所述开机时获取当前智能卡中的预设信息通过所述预设处理算法处理后得到的第二信息,包括:开机时从当前智能卡获取第二信息,所述第二信息为所述当前智能卡中的预设信息通过所述预设处理算法处理后得到。4.根据权利要求1所述的方法,其特征在于,所述存储智能卡中的预设信息通过预设处理算法处理后得到的第一信息之前,还包括:开启个人化检查功能并设置对应的个人化控制键;接收待验证的个人化控制键,并确认所述个人化控制键验证成功。5.根据权利要求4所述的方法,其特征在于,还包括:若关闭所述个人化检查功能,则删除存储的第一信息;或,若关闭所述个人化检查功能,则询问用户是否删除存储的第一信息;若接收到确定删除存储的第一信息的指令,则删除存储的第一信息。6.一种智能卡的个人化...

【专利技术属性】
技术研发人员:赵春平
申请(专利权)人:北京信威通信技术股份有限公司
类型:发明
国别省市:北京,11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1